So I just got my CDL a week ago and I've filled out a bunch of apps online. Haven't heard back from any yet, granted its been less than a week, should I be calling them even though I've already filled out online apps for them? I did pickup some apps at a couple places that were local and turned them in. I do have a good driving record and no criminal. Only thing is I have poor work history...4 different jobs in 2 years. Any advice?

With no exp you need to be applying to the starter companies where there is training.Because you should have heard back from at least 1 company by now to let you know they received your application.Your job history wont be a factor.Unless the local companies have someone to train you they won't hire you.

Recent grad here, in the thick of applying. Finding that many do not respond. Could be that you don't meet the requirements, but you may have to call to find that out. As Chinatown said, follow up after a couple of days with a phone call. At that time you'll probably get a recruiter who will provide information about the job, answer questions and help you over the hurdles. Good luck!

Did u get your cdl through a school, or one of these fly by night train in my truck deals. Some don't recognize the fly by night places. Also this is normally the beginning of the.slow season so maybe you might get a call mid January if freight picks up.
-
Went through a 4 week program at a private school. Yeah I figured it might have to do with the fact that this is the time that certain types of freight do slow down.
